What Is Augmented Reality in Dental Treatment Plans?

Augmented reality (AR) is a technology that overlays virtual images or information onto the real world. In dentistry, AR allows dental professionals to project 3D visualizations of the patient’s teeth, gums, and treatment options directly onto the patient’s mouth or dental chart. By using AR, dentists can walk patients through their treatment plans in a more dynamic and interactive way, helping them better understand the procedure, its goals, and the expected results.

For example, a patient considering dental implants can view a 3D model of their mouth, with the proposed implants placed directly in the visualization. They can see how the implants will fit, how they’ll change the appearance of their smile, and even how the treatment will affect their overall oral health.

How Does Augmented Reality Work in Dental Treatment Planning?

1. 3D Visualization of Dental Structures

The first step in using AR for treatment planning involves capturing a 3D scan of the patient’s mouth. This can be done using intraoral scanners or 3D imaging technology, which creates an accurate, detailed digital model of the teeth, gums, and jaw. Once the scan is complete, the dentist can overlay a 3D representation of the proposed treatment on this digital model.

For example, if the patient needs a crown, the AR system can show how the crown will look in place, how it will match the surrounding teeth, and how it will function in the patient’s mouth. This visualization helps patients see the end result before any procedure begins.

2. Real-Time Adjustments and Interactive Feedback

One of the standout features of AR in treatment planning is the ability to make real-time adjustments based on the patient’s preferences or concerns. If the patient is unsure about the size or shape of a proposed crown or implant, the dentist can modify the design in real-time, showing the patient how different adjustments will impact their treatment.

Patients can interact with the AR display, zooming in to see details, rotating the 3D model to view the treatment from different angles, and even asking questions as they visualize the changes. This level of interactivity enhances patient engagement and helps build trust between the patient and the dental provider.

3. Interactive Demonstrations of Procedures

AR also allows dentists to demonstrate complex dental procedures in a way that’s easy for patients to understand. Instead of simply explaining what will happen during a treatment, the dentist can show a step-by-step AR visualization of the procedure, helping patients better grasp the process.

For example, a patient undergoing a root canal can watch an AR simulation of the procedure, understanding the steps involved, the tools used, and the expected outcome. By demystifying the process, AR helps reduce anxiety and fear associated with dental procedures.

4. Patient Education and Empowerment

AR is a powerful tool for patient education. When patients can visualize their treatment plan, they are more likely to feel informed and confident in their decision. AR offers a visual learning experience, which is often more effective than simply explaining the process verbally or with diagrams. Patients can ask questions, explore different treatment options, and see the potential outcomes in a clear, interactive format.

Benefits of Using Augmented Reality in Treatment Planning

1. Improved Patient Understanding

One of the most significant benefits of AR in dental treatment planning is its ability to improve patient understanding. Complex procedures, such as orthodontics, implant placements, or cosmetic treatments, can be difficult for patients to comprehend. With AR, patients can see a real-time visual representation of their treatment options, making it easier for them to understand what’s being proposed and why it’s necessary.

By viewing 3D models, patients are able to gain a clearer picture of their treatment, its benefits, and the expected results, leading to more informed decisions about their care.

2. Enhanced Communication Between Dentist and Patient

Effective communication is key to building trust and ensuring patient satisfaction. AR enhances communication by allowing the dentist to visually demonstrate treatment options in a way that words alone cannot. This shared visual experience ensures that both the patient and dentist are on the same page regarding treatment goals, outcomes, and expectations.

3. Reduced Patient Anxiety

Dental anxiety is a common issue, particularly for patients undergoing complex procedures. AR helps reduce this anxiety by providing transparency in the treatment process. When patients can visualize their treatment from start to finish, it helps alleviate fear and uncertainty. They feel more empowered and confident in their decision-making process, knowing exactly what to expect.

4. More Accurate Treatment Planning

AR allows dentists to make precise adjustments to the treatment plan, ensuring that the proposed treatment aligns perfectly with the patient’s needs. By viewing the treatment in 3D and making real-time adjustments, dentists can fine-tune their approach, resulting in better outcomes and more personalized care.

5. Enhanced Patient Engagement and Satisfaction

When patients are actively involved in their treatment planning and can interact with the AR system, they are more likely to feel engaged and satisfied with their care. The ability to visualize their treatment plan not only improves understanding but also enhances the overall patient experience. Engaged patients are more likely to adhere to the treatment plan and follow through with recommended procedures.
